Q: Why do events duplicate after a Wrenfold calendar sync conflict?

A: When the Tidemark connector detects conflicting edits, it forks the event rather than merging, which older clients render as duplicates. Run the dedupe task after resolving the conflict; do not delete either copy manually. To run the task, unlock the maintainer console with the passphrase below.

vault phrase of kawep-tahog = ulaix-briath

Subject: DR drill — sqlint-forge config restore

Hi Ravel,

As part of Thursday's disaster-recovery drill we'll simulate loss of the Lintharbor server that hosts our SQL linting rules for the Quartzdale warehouse repos. The drill restores the `sqlint-forge` ruleset bundle from cold backup and re-enables the pre-merge checks. No action needed from release management during the window, but you'll need the vault unlock to validate afterward. The recovery passphrase for the backup vault is below.

unlock words, hahip-baduf: holwyn-istath-julvan

Subject: Date localization on-call notes

Hi Tavish,

Welcome aboard. Since you're new to Quillmere's Chronofmt library, please note that all date rendering flows through the locale resolver, never through manual string formatting. Most incidents trace back to stale locale bundles or missing fallback rules. Before touching any code, read the resolver design notes carefully. The full localization playbook is kept on this internal page.

runbook for badug-kadup: https://confluence.zemvarlabs.internal/projects/browse/display/projects/bd1b

Subject: DR drill Thursday — fan-out backpressure

On-call: during the Hartwell drill we'll throttle the Plumeline notifier to force queue backpressure. Expect alert storms around 14:00; suppress per the runbook. Verify the dead-letter drain recovers within ten minutes. If the standby broker needs manual unseal, enter the recovery passphrase below.

unlock words, bawip-bawip: rusiel-caseth-norax-tameth-zorvan-silax-frador-oliath-caswyn-noveth-keliel-gilmir-pelox

Q: How do staff use the shuttle-bus gate at the Dreyfell campus? A: The gate on Larkwood Lane opens only for the morning and evening shuttle runs. Riders must board inside the gate; drivers will not stop on the road. Facilities desk unlocks the pedestrian turnstile fifteen minutes before each departure. If the turnstile reader fails, use the manual keypad beside it with the code shown below.

door code, tahop-fahap: bdg-JZCXMY-37375484